在数字化时代,大数据平台已经成为企业提升竞争力的重要基础设施。我曾经参与过一家大型企业的大数据平台建设,以下是我的一些实践经验和心得,希望能为大家提供一些参考。
一、明确建设目标与需求
我们需要明确大数据平台的建设目标和需求。在我的项目中,我们希望通过大数据平台实现以下几点:
1. 数据整合:将来自不同系统的数据进行整合,形成一个统一的数据视图。
2. 数据分析:利用大数据技术对整合后的数据进行深度分析,为企业决策提供支持。
3. 数据挖掘:从海量数据中挖掘出有价值的信息,为业务创新提供数据支撑。
二、技术选型与架构设计
在技术选型方面,我们需要根据企业的实际情况和需求来选择合适的工具和平台。以下是我当时的一些选择:
1. 数据存储:采用分布式文件系统HDFS,它可以存储海量数据,并支持高吞吐量的数据读写。
2. 数据处理:使用Apache Hadoop和Apache Spark进行数据处理和分析,它们能够处理大规模的数据集,并提供高效的数据处理能力。
3. 数据仓库:构建数据仓库,使用Apache Hive和Apache Impala进行数据查询和分析。
架构设计上,我们采用了以下分层架构:
数据采集层:负责数据的采集和初步处理。
数据存储层:负责数据的存储和管理。
数据处理层:负责数据的清洗、转换和分析。
应用层:提供数据可视化、报表生成等应用服务。
三、实践案例
在我的项目中,我们通过大数据平台成功实现了以下案例:
客户画像分析:通过对客户数据的分析,为企业提供了精准营销的策略。
供应链优化:通过分析供应链数据,优化库存管理,降低物流成本。
风险控制:利用大数据分析技术,对企业面临的信用风险进行预测和控制。
与展望
大数据平台的建设是一个复杂的过程,需要综合考虑技术、业务、成本等多方面因素。通过我的实践,我总结出以下几点:
1. 需求先行:明确建设目标和需求是成功的关键。
2. 技术适配:选择合适的技术和架构,确保平台的高效稳定运行。
3. 持续优化:大数据平台不是一成不变的,需要根据业务发展和技术进步不断优化。
未来,随着人工智能、云计算等技术的发展,大数据平台将更加智能化、自动化,为企业创造更大的价值。
发表评论 取消回复